Machina Speculatrix's Avatar

Machina Speculatrix

@mspeculatrix

Journalist, writer, photographer, maker and electronics botherer. I like to tinker with electronics, robotics, home automation and other tech projects until they either work or catch fire. https://mspeculatrix.substack.com/

8
Followers
25
Following
29
Posts
27.10.2025
Joined
Posts Following

Latest posts by Machina Speculatrix @mspeculatrix

Preview
Adding extended memory to a homebrew computer The CPU in your homebrew microcomputer can access more memory than you might at first think, so long as you arrange things the right way.

How I added extended ROM and RAM to my #6502 #homebrew computer. (Medium sub required.)

medium.com/@mansfield.d...

#tech #technology #maker #computer #electronics #retrocomputing #retro #hobby

20.02.2026 13:17 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Preview
Creating a smart servo controller for robotics Servo motors give your machine agency, so long as you can control them.

Playing around with servos - my latest article on Machina Speculatrix (Medium sub required).

medium.com/machina-spec...

#tech #technology #maker #computer #electronics #microcontrollers #hobby #robotics

04.02.2026 13:24 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Preview
Inventing a serial protocol for smart sensors We need to talk. And when I say β€˜we’, I mean smart sensor devices and their microcontroller overlords.

My latest article (Medium sub required): I made a serial protocol for a #robotics projects. I'm not saying it's a *good* idea...

medium.com/machina-spec...

#coding #programming #tech #maker #robot #tech #technology #computer #electronics #microcontrollers #hobby

28.01.2026 19:59 πŸ‘ 2 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Preview
SparkFun cuts ties with Adafruit in harassment dispute : Adafruit claims SparkFun aims to shoot the messenger for criticizing corporate tolerance of intolerance

Looks like I won’t be placing any more orders at #Sparkfun after its disgraceful behaviour towards #Adafruit.

www.theregister.com/2026/01/15/s...

#maker #electronics #teensy #makers #hacking

15.01.2026 09:23 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Preview
Using a Raspberry Pi for storage on a homebrew computer There are many options for mass storage with a homebrew microcomputer. So why not ignore them all and make your own?

Using a #RaspberryPi to give my 6502 machine some file storage. (Medium sub required)

medium.com/machina-spec...

#tech #technology #maker #computer #electronics #homebrew #microcontrollers #hobby

09.01.2026 14:13 πŸ‘ 5 πŸ” 1 πŸ’¬ 0 πŸ“Œ 0
Preview
AVR Basics: Introduction to coding for modern AVR microcontrollers The β€˜new generation’ AVR chips are fast and powerful but require a slightly different approach when coding in C/C++.

My latest article in Machina Speculatrix: working with 'new generation' or 'modern' AVR microcontrollers. (Medium sub required).

medium.com/machina-spec...

#tech #technology #maker #computer #electronics #homebrew #microcontrollers #hobby #coding #programming

30.12.2025 15:49 πŸ‘ 2 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

Today I shall mostly be focusing on developing a new #serial protocol for #robots. And wrapping presents. But mainly the serial thing.

#maker #robotics #tech #technology

24.12.2025 07:19 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Preview
Making smart sensors for robotics Sensors are key to intelligent robots, but they become really useful when they have some smarts of their own

I decided to resurrect a #robotics project, but this time I'm starting with 'smart' #sensors. Here's my first article (Medium sub required).

medium.com/p/d0c55505987c

#tech #technology #maker #computer #electronics #homebrew #microcontrollers #hobby

23.12.2025 19:37 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Preview
AVR Basics: Programming the AVR 0-series with UPDI The AVR0 microcontrollers work a little differently to the chips you might be used to. But making the switch isn’t hard.

My latest piece in Machina Speculatrix - #programming #AVR 0-series #microcontrollers via UPDI (Medium sub required).

medium.com/machina-spec...

#maker #tech #technology #makers #computer #electronics #homebrew #hobby

13.12.2025 11:50 πŸ‘ 1 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Preview
A homebrew CPU board with flash ROM Replacing an EEPROM with flash memory to hold the operating system makes development faster. How hard can it be?

My latest article in Machina Speculatrix (Medium sub required). Using flash instead of an EEPROM. It sort of worked.

medium.com/machina-spec...

#tech #technology #maker #computer #electronics #homebrew #microcontrollers #hobby

04.12.2025 09:10 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Preview
A better homebrew serial port, but still obsolete It can happen that, just as you’re getting comfortable with a piece of technology, they take it away.

Making a better #serial port for my #6502 #homebrew #computer. Still obsolete, though. (Medium sub required.)

medium.com/machina-spec...

#tech #technology #maker #electronics #hobby

25.11.2025 11:03 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Preview
From the archive: WordStar 2000 Plus reviews Software bloat is not a new thing: it was happening as far back as 1988.

My reviews of WordStar 2000 Plus from 1988. Apparently I actually liked it! (Medium sub required.)

medium.com/machina-spec...

#tech #technology #computer #software #retrocomputing #vintagecomputing #review

18.11.2025 13:13 πŸ‘ 1 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

Yeah, I did check the rise and fall times with the scope. All looked good. I'm glad to say the issues had since been resolved and everything's working great.

18.11.2025 13:12 πŸ‘ 1 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Screengrab of logic analyser software showing signals in an electronic device

Screengrab of logic analyser software showing signals in an electronic device

Gah! So the prototype worked, and all the signals on the new PCB are doing what they're supposed to. But it ain't working.

Must be a timing thing.

Don't mind me. Just grumbling out loud.

#tech #technology #maker #computer #electronics

13.11.2025 10:22 πŸ‘ 2 πŸ” 0 πŸ’¬ 1 πŸ“Œ 0
Preview
Getting to grips with real-time clocks So I decided that I’d like to add a real-time clock to my homebrew computer. How hard could it be?

New article on Machina Speculatrix (Medium sub required). Battling RTC chips

medium.com/machina-spec...

#tech #technology #maker #computer #electronics

13.11.2025 10:15 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Close-up photograph of red printed circuit boards.

Close-up photograph of red printed circuit boards.

Another day, another new batch of PCBs. These ones have me slightly intimidated, but I hope to write about them soon on Machina Speculatrix.

mspeculatrix.substack.com

#tech #technology #maker #electronics

10.11.2025 19:11 πŸ‘ 1 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

Pro tip: Don’t shave in the vicinity of a breadboard. That is all.

#electronics #maker #tech #technology

09.11.2025 11:47 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Abstract photograph of a metal surface with areas of rust some of which hint at the former presence of text.

Abstract photograph of a metal surface with areas of rust some of which hint at the former presence of text.

Can you read it?

linktr.ee/zolachrome

#photography #originalphotography #artphotography #abstract

09.11.2025 08:40 πŸ‘ 6 πŸ” 1 πŸ’¬ 0 πŸ“Œ 0

Maybe we need to update #RTFM. Manuals are rare these days. The information you need is online, as PDF datasheets, forum posts, Git gists. It should be RTFAI (β€˜Available Information’). Perhaps just RTFI. Or we could just say β€˜Read’, followed (if you feel strongly) by FFS. RFFS?

#tech #technology

09.11.2025 11:16 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Preview
Creating a dev board for an ATmega microcontroller Experimenting with tiny, surface-mount microcontrollers is a lot easier with a breakout board.

Trying to make it easier to play with an SMD microcontroller. New article on Machina Speculatrix (for subscribers).

mspeculatrix.substack.com/p/creating-a...

#electronics #maker #microcontroller #AVR #tech #technology #PCB

07.11.2025 20:26 πŸ‘ 2 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
A collection of purple printed circuit boards.

A collection of purple printed circuit boards.

Any day you get new PCBs is the post is a good day. I’ll be writing about these soon.

mspeculatrix.substack.com

#tech #technology #maker #electronics #pcb

05.11.2025 11:12 πŸ‘ 2 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Preview
AVR programming: a dev environment The toolset you use to program a microcontroller is a very personal choice. This is what I landed on.

This is how I go about writing #code for #AVR #microcontrollers. (For subscribers).

mspeculatrix.substack.com/p/avr-progra...

#tech #technology #maker #computer #computer #programming #coding #atmega

03.11.2025 15:45 πŸ‘ 1 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Preview
Elliott 405: Mainframe computing 1950s-style A small treasure trove of documents gives a taste of computing the vintage mainframe way.

A trip back to 1950s-style #mainframe #computing. New article for subscribers in Machina Speculatrix.

mspeculatrix.substack.com/p/elliott-40...

#tech #technology #maker #computer #computer #retrocomputing #vintagecomputing

31.10.2025 10:52 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Preview
Fun with chips: SN76489 sound generator IC Audio is an important component of a computer’s power. And producing sound can be surprisingly simple.

New piece in Machina Speculatrix (for subscribers).

mspeculatrix.substack.com/p/fun-with-c...

#tech #technology #maker #electronics

30.10.2025 09:27 πŸ‘ 1 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Preview
From the archive: Amstrad PPC 640 review This was one of the strangest PCs I ever used. Luckily, I didn’t have to use it for long.

Back in the day I got to review the #Amstrad PPC 640. Seems like I wasn't impressed.

mspeculatrix.substack.com/p/from-the-a...

#tech #technology #computer #computer #retro #retrocomputing #vintage #vintagecomputing #review

29.10.2025 10:30 πŸ‘ 1 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Post image

Finding myself increasing drawn towards the #AVR 0-series #microcontrollers, especially the small but capable ATtiny1604. I'm toying with the idea of a breakout board for it. Should I do it?

#tech #technology #maker #electronics

29.10.2025 09:32 πŸ‘ 1 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0

Today I shall mostly be hanging my head in shame at having reversed the polarity of the power wires going to a #sensor. That sensor is now having a lie down, perhaps forever.

#tech #technology #maker #electronics

29.10.2025 08:49 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Preview
Zolatron: A homebrew computer of my own There’s no better way to understand computers than to design and build one of your own. All you have to do is go back in time.

Starting to move my #homebrew #computer posts over to Substack.

mspeculatrix.substack.com/p/zolatron-a...

#tech #technology #maker #computer #computer #retro #retrocomputing #vintage #vintagecomputing

28.10.2025 10:28 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Preview
The joy of AVR 8-bit microcontrollers Microcontrollers are becoming insanely fast and capable. But there’s something about the simpler types that appeals.

Why I love microcontrollers. Starting to move the Machina Speculatrix blog to Substack.

mspeculatrix.substack.com/p/the-joy-of...

#tech #technology #maker #computer #computer #electronics #code #coding #programming

27.10.2025 15:16 πŸ‘ 1 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0
Preview
Creating a serial interface for a homebrew computer It’s not really a computer unless it has input and output. And a serial interface can handle both of those tasks.

My first attempt at a serial interface for my #homebrew computer. (Medium sub required.)

medium.com/machina-spec...

#tech #technology #maker #computer #computer #retro #retrocomputing #vintage #vintagecomputing

27.10.2025 13:30 πŸ‘ 0 πŸ” 0 πŸ’¬ 0 πŸ“Œ 0